Scientists called the glacial burst in Uttarakhand a "very rare incident". They said that satellite and Google Earth images did not show a glacial lake near the region. There was a possibility of 'water pockets' (lakes inside the glaciers) which might have burst. The entire Hindu-Kush Himalayan region has emerged as a climate change hotspot over the years. The event reminded Indian planners that the frontier of climate change is very close to home.
